The D-Tap to Panasonic DMW-BLF19 Dummy Battery Cable from IndiPRO Tools enables you to power your GH4 camera or another compatible device using a pro-style battery or another power source with a D-Tap port. This 28" cable outputs a constant 9.2V to power your camera without introducing noise. It features a D-Tap connector on one end and a dummy battery that fits into your camera's battery compartment on the other end.
- DMW-BLF19-Type Dummy Battery
- Regulated 9.2V Power Converter
- Accepts 11 to 17 VDC
- 28" Cable End-to-End

Oh boy. It doesn't properly fit.
If you buy this item 2 things will probably happen: You'll open the package and take the battery out. You'll place the battery into your camera (GH4 or GH5) and as you push the battery in you'll soon discover that the placement of the cable on the dummy battery doesn't allow for it to be inserted all the way into the camera. The cable placement not only blocks the battery from being properly placed into the camera but it also doesn't even line up with the little flap that houses the dummy battery cable.
